Unlocking Business Potential with Lookalikes
In marketing, a lookalike strategy involves leveraging data to find and target new potential customers who resemble your best existing ones. For instance, Facebook allows you to create a lookalike audience based on customers who have already interacted with your brand. Practical Lookalike Strategies
Website Optimization
Analyze your website metrics to determine which pages keep visitors engaged the longest. Use this data to design future pages that emplace similar successful elements, such as eye-catching headlines or visually appealing fonts.
Copywriting for Engagement
Review the headlines and subject lines that have previously attracted clicks and engagement. Use these as a template to craft new, lookalike content that taps into the established patterns of success.
Sales Enhancement
Identify your top-selling products and consider expanding on these successes. Create bundles or spin-offs that complement what your customers already love.
